Uber's women-only rides are now available across the US.
Uber just made it easier for women to ride and drive with each other, rolling out its "Women Preferences" feature nationwide in the US.
After starting in Los Angeles, San Francisco, and Detroit last year, the option quickly expanded to big cities like New York City and Atlanta thanks to strong user feedback.
Women can now choose to ride with other women
With this feature, female riders can choose to be matched with female drivers and even set preferences in advance.
Drivers can opt in or out anytime. It's also open to Uber Teen accounts.
Uber says the feature responds to feedback from women who asked for the option to match with other women.
The feature has powered over 230 million trips
Launched first in Saudi Arabia back in 2019, "Women Preferences" has now powered over 230 million trips across more than 40 countries, including Germany, France, Brazil, and Spain, showing just how much demand there is for safer and more comfortable rides worldwide.
